We were so excited to celebrate my mother’s 55th birthday today and of all the restaurants in Dallas, she wanted to go to Meso Maya. She had been there before and enjoyed the drinks. After canceling the reservations I made for her at fine dining establishments, we showed up for our 4pm reservation at Meso Maya. From the moment we walked in, we felt as if we weren’t welcomed. The hostess apparently couldn’t find our reservation; but proceeded to seat us anyway. Our server, I believe his name was Jose or Juan, treated us as if we were there for happy hour and nothing more. First, he swung cocktail napkins in front of each person at our table asking us for drink orders as if we were sitting at the bar. We were also given lunch menus even though I made the reservation for dinner. We never got a chance get comfortable and enjoy anything we ordered including all appetizers, entrees, and cocktails because we were rushed the entire time- meanwhile the restaurant was empty. I can only imagine what the service would’ve been like; had my husband, who’s Hispanic, hadn’t of been there. It wasn’t until he started speaking to our waiter in Spanish for him to ease up a bit. What made matters worst, they never acknowledged my mom for her birthday. We weren’t looking for a free dessert and would have been glad to buy one for her, but once we were done eating the mediocre food, we were ready to go. We spent about $250 for a table of four and STILL left an $80 tip even though the service wasn’t great. But one thing’s for sure, we will never dine at Meso Maya ever again.
